The latest VR news is a sobering reminder of how tough the industry can be right now. Long-time VR powerhouse Survios has reportedly suffered critical layoffs that have effectively shuttered the studio. LinkedIn posts from employees confirm that the majority of the development team has been affected, with one combat designer writing, “I was informed today that Survios as it currently stands will be essentially shuttered.”

Over the past decade Survios delivered nine VR titles, including massive hits like Alien: Rogue Incursion (which topped PSVR2 charts), Creed: Rise to Glory (over 1 million copies sold), Raw Data, and The Walking Dead: Onslaught. Their success proved that high-quality, story-driven VR experiences could find an audience — yet even they couldn’t weather the current market pressures.

This comes after the studio had expanded beyond pure VR with PC/console ports of Alien: Rogue Incursion, showing how difficult it is for even proven teams to stay sustainable.
